(Silvan Paternostro) data view (born in 1962 in Barranquilla, Colombia; she has written extensively on Cuba and Central and South America as well as on women's issues, AIDS, revolutionary movements, underground economies, and the intersection of culture with politics and economics; her books include: In the Land of God and Man; Se Habla Español: Voces Latinas en USA, the first anthology of new Latino voices in the United States published in Spanish; My Colombian War: A Journey Through the Country I Left Behind (Henry Holt, 2007), she is a contributing editor of Bomb magazine and a frequent contributor to The New York Times Magazine, Newsweek Magazine, The Paris Review, The New Republic, and numerous other publications; she was also associate producer on Che: The Argentine and Che: Guerrilla, a two part movie); she lives in New York City and Colombia)
